div#year    { width:580px; margin:0em auto; float:left; }
div.holder  { font-family:monospace; float:left; border:1px solid #006c00; }
pre         { margin:0; color: #fae2af}
pre.month   { background:#006000; color:#ffffff; border-bottom:0px solid #15b015; }
pre.wkday   { background-image: url('images/button1.jpg'); }
.green      { background:#ff6d6d; 
              color:#000000;
              border: 0px solid #ff6d6d;
}
.datehigh   { color: #ff6d6d;
              border-top-width: 0px;
              border-bottom-width: 0px;
              border-left-width: 0px;
              border-right-width: 1px;
}
pre.bookc   { background:#006000; color:#ffffff; }
a           { text-decoration: none }
a:visited   { text-decoration: none }
a:active    { text-decoration: none }
a:hover     { text-decoration: none }
